Feb 9, 2022 · Here’s the jist of it: Dab a dry chip brush in a tiny bit of light gray paint, then off-load the brush on a paper plate to ensure very little paint on the tips. Then, paint / highlight the raised areas of the stone to add depth. Start with a tiny amount of highlights. Add more highlights if desired.

Before the painting process begins, you'll need to protect the area around the fireplace. Mask off the mantle and the trim. Then add a drop cloth to protect the floors. Make sure the fireplace is clean of any dirt and debris before applying any paint. 2. Tape Off Fireplace Surround. Next, you’ll want to tape off the surrounding area. This will be different for every fireplace project. It might be a wood mantel surround or just regular drywall. In this case, I have a small wood trim which I chose to also paint. Painting the trim and stone creates a wider visual look for this narrow fireplace.

It is a good multipurpose primer that is compatible with masonry. (Without primer, porous stone or brick will soak up a huge amount of paint.) Next I applied a light base color to the whole fireplace. Once the ...The average temperature range a fireplace burns at is between 1,200 degrees and 1,500 degrees Fahrenheit, and most regular paints are not designed to be heat-resistant above 200 degrees Fahrenheit. Choosing heat-resistant paint ensures that it won’t bubble, chip, and peel or cause toxic fumes when it’s mixed with high heat.Apr 7, 2016 ...
